"True Tales of the Weird - A Record of Personal Experiences of the Supernatural" contains accounts of personal experiences of 'ghosts' and the supernatural from the early twentieth century. Although the author didn't personally believe in ghosts, he wanted to publish this volume for future scientific interest.
